How a worksheet speeds up quotation review

Disc spring quotations slow down when the inquiry only says Belleville washer or DIN 2093 without geometry, force, working deflection, stack direction, material and service conditions. A worksheet puts the missing inputs in one place before engineering review starts.

This is especially useful for custom stacks, valve live loading, flange bolting, high-temperature service and corrosive environments where a catalog size alone cannot confirm the final solution.

What to send if some data is still missing

If some fields are not available yet, send the drawing or available dimensions, target load, working movement, stack idea, material preference, temperature, media, quantity and certificate requirements first.

FeTech can then identify what is still missing and confirm whether the next step should be standard size selection, custom calculation, material review or a sample discussion.

Does a catalog size table replace engineering review?

No. A catalog helps identify standard geometry, but critical applications still need load, fatigue, temperature, corrosion, friction, support surface and installation review.
